侧身向南边 发表于 2012-10-24 23:21:19

ORACLE HANDBOOK系列之十:计划任务(Scheduler)

ORACLE HANDBOOK系列之十:计划任务(Scheduler)

    <div class="postText">10G中引入了SCHEDULER,其强大的功能远超9I中的JOB,比如在其定期执行任务时引入的repeat_interval,使得我们可以极其自由地设置任务的执行时间;比如其允许ORACLE执行外部程序或调用操作系统命令;又比如新引入的事件、CHAIN、时间窗等高级概念,本文演示其基本用法,想深入研究的可移步 君三思文章http://www.5ienet.com/note/html/scheduler/)
1.    简单回顾一下9i中Job的用法
declarejid number;begindbms_job.submit(job      => jid,                  what   => 'begin insert into old_job_test values(sysdate, ''abc''); commit; end;',                  interval => 'trunc(sysdate,''mi'')+3/24/60');commit;dbms_output.put_line(jid);end;
页: [1]
查看完整版本: ORACLE HANDBOOK系列之十:计划任务(Scheduler)